BIT’s 5th World Congress of Biotechnology (ibio-2012), successfully held in Xi’an International Conference Center on April 25-28, 2012. Totally, there were nearly 400 participants from more than 32 countries and areas have attended the ibio-2012.
As the distinguished keynote speakers, Dr. Rolf G. Werner, Professor, Eberhard Karls University of Tuebingen, Germany; Dr. Juergen Logemann, Director Global Technology Acquisition & Innovation Management, BASF Plant Science GmbH, Germany; Dr. Francesco Salamini, President, Fondazione Edmund Mach( FEM )Foundation, Italy; Dr. German Spangenberg, Professor, Department of Primary Industries and La Trobe University, Australia made wonderful presentations and discussed heatedly with the audiences at keynote forum.
14 selected sessions covered 9 fields including Synthetic Biology and Sustainable Productivity, Industrial Microbiology, Food Biotechnology, Environmental Biotechnology, Agriculture and Plant Biotechnology, Biomaterials and Tissue Engineering, Pharmaceutical Biotechnology, Medical Biotechnology and Biomedical Devices and Equipment, Yeasts in Biotechnology: Achievements, Problems, Perspectives. ibio-2012 brought together academic professors, industrial leaders, policy makers and investors to share their new research and achievements, warmly discussed and analyzed the sustainability development of Biotechnology. BIT's 4th Annual World Congress of Industrial Biotechnology (IBIO-2011), successfully held in Dalian World Expo Center on April 25-30, 2011. Totally, there were nearly 300 participants from more than 30 countries and areas have attended the IBIO-2011.
As the keynote speakers, Dr. Jürgen Logemann, Director Research and Global In-Licensing, BASF Plant Science Company GmbH, Germany; Dr. Rene F. Labatut, Vice President, Global Manufacturing Technology, Sanofi Pasteur, France; Dr. Bernhard van Lengerich, Chief Science Officer, VP Technology Strategy, General Mills, USA and Dr. Paul A. Stewart, Director, Global Business Development, Eli Lilly and Company Elanco Animal Health Division ,USA made excellent presentations and warmly discussed with the audiences at keynote forum. More...
